Delta 9-tetrahydrocannabinol (delta 9-THC), the major psychoactive component of marijuana, has been shown to suppress macrophage soluble cytolytic activity. The purpose of this study was to determine whether delta 9-THC inhibited this function by affecting tumor necrosis factor-alpha (TNF-alpha).

The major psychoactive component of marijuana, delta 9-tetrahydrocannabinol (THC), has been shown to suppress the functions of various immune cells.
